Calls for rethink over new bus route proposals

PASSENGERS have urged a regional operator to listen to local voices amid proposed changes to a key bus route.
Arriva is currently consulting on plans to revise the X22 service between Peterlee and Middlesbrough.
Two options under consideration include maintaining the route as it is, with links to Stockton and the University Hospital of North Tees Hospital, or revising the service to connect it to Newton Aycliffe and Darlington instead.
News of the proposal has led to one county councillor warning that residents are being forced to make an “impossible” decision.
Arriva said the survey will help it understand how to improve the service. Megan Hall, who works at North Tees Hospital, said the direct link is vital to the local community.
“It's very worrying that this has even become a topic for discussion,” she said. “I often use the bus to travel to and from work, as do many other colleagues.
“The X22 will also be used for students going to Teesside University, teams who work at Tesco's in Stockton and I'm sure many other places of work. Having to choose between the two routes seems awfully unfair and somewhat crazy.
